👶 What Are the Common Eye Problems in Children?

Here are some of the most frequently diagnosed pediatric eye conditions:

🔹 1. Refractive Errors
  • • Myopia (nearsightedness), hyperopia (farsightedness), and astigmatism
  • • Often missed in school-aged children
  • • Symptoms: squinting, headaches, sitting too close to the TV or books
🔹 2. Amblyopia (Lazy Eye)
  • • One eye has reduced vision due to improper development
  • • Needs early treatment to avoid permanent vision loss
🔹 3. Strabismus (Squint)
  • • Misalignment of the eyes
  • • May lead to double vision or lazy eye if untreated
🔹 4. Congenital Cataract
  • • Present at birth
  • • Requires early surgical intervention to preserve vision
🔹 5. Allergic Eye Disease
  • • Common in children prone to allergies
  • • Causes red, itchy, watery eyes
🔹 6. Digital Eye Strain
  • • Increasingly common due to prolonged screen exposure
  • • Leads to fatigue, blurred vision, and dry eyes
🔹 7. Eye Injuries
  • • From sports, toys, or accidents
  • • Requires immediate attention to prevent vision loss

🧪 How Do We Diagnose Eye Problems in Children?

At our pediatric eye clinic, we use child-friendly diagnostic tools and techniques to accurately assess vision and eye health :

  • • Visual acuity testing (age-appropriate)
  • • Cycloplegic refraction (to detect hidden power)
  • • Ocular alignment tests
  • • Stereo vision testing
  • • Dilated fundus examination
  • • Retinoscopy and corneal light reflex
  • • Digital eye imaging and OCT (when needed)

🕒 Why Early Identification of Pediatric Eye Problems is Crucial

👁️ 80% of learning in early childhood is visual. Uncorrected vision issues can impact:

  • • Academic performance
  • • Social interaction
  • • Self-confidence
  • • Long-term eye development
  • Delays in detecting issues like amblyopia or squint can lead to irreversible vision problems. Early intervention leads to the best treatment outcomes and normal visual development.

    📅 How Often Should Children Have Eye Checkups?

    Age Eye Checkup Recommendations
    Birth – 6 months Initial screening by paediatrician.
    6 months – 1 year Eye exam if family history of eye issues.
    3 years First detailed eye check-up with an ophthalmologist.
    5–6 years Before school entry.
    Every 1–2 years During school-going years or as advised.
